The Mechanics of a Live Session

Understanding the structure of a reddit live discussion is key to participating effectively. These events are scheduled in advance, giving the community time to prepare questions and mark their calendars. Once the stream begins, the host moderates the conversation, often weaving together prepared remarks with live questions from the chat. The interface supports text-based chat, ensuring accessibility for all users, while the top questions are frequently highlighted to guide the dialogue.

Planning and Promotion

Successful sessions do not happen by accident. Organizers typically announce the topic, guest list, and time weeks in advance through posts and social channels. This pre-planning phase is crucial for building momentum and ensuring a diverse audience. Clear communication about the rules, such as how questions are submitted, sets the stage for a smooth and productive conversation.

Benefits for Community Engagement

The primary advantage of this format is the immediacy of the interaction. Unlike traditional forums where replies can lag for hours, a live discussion creates a shared timeline of thoughts and reactions. This fosters a more authentic connection between participants and allows for nuanced debates that can evolve organically. The energy of a live event can elevate a community, turning passive readers into active contributors.

Accessibility and Reach

Because the platform is text-based, it removes the barriers associated with video or audio streaming. Users can join from any device, contributing without the need for high bandwidth or a webcam. This inclusivity broadens the potential audience, allowing for a more diverse range of voices to be heard in the conversation, from different geographical locations and backgrounds.

Despite its advantages, hosting a reddit live discussion requires careful management. The chat can move quickly, making it difficult to address every comment. Spammers or disruptive users can appear, requiring moderators to be vigilant. Establishing a team of trusted moderators is essential to maintain a respectful and on-topic environment, ensuring the conversation remains valuable for everyone involved.

Best Practices for Hosts

Effective moderation is an art form. A skilled host will balance speaking time, gently steer the conversation back on track if it wanders, and ensure that quieter participants feel invited to share. They act as the bridge between the guest and the audience, framing questions and summarizing key points to maintain clarity throughout the session.
